USBPRINT\PrinterPOS-802BC2 a hardware identification string (Hardware ID) for a generic 80mm Thermal Receipt Printer , typically used in point-of-sale (POS) systems

. This specific ID often appears in Windows Device Manager when a printer is connected but lacks the correct manufacturer-specific driver. Overview of the POS-80 Thermal Printer

Most 80mm models include an integrated blade to automatically cut receipts after printing. Troubleshooting & Driver Installation

If your computer identifies the device as "USBPRINT\PrinterPOS-802BC2," it usually means the system is using a generic USB printing support driver rather than the full functional driver required for features like the auto-cutter or specific fonts. Identify the Manufacturer:

Look for a label on the bottom of the printer. Common brands include Xprinter, Munbyn, or POS-X. Download Official Drivers: For many generic Chinese models, the Xprinter Support Page

provides a "Neutral Driver" that works across various brands. Usbprint Printerpos-802bc2

hardware, specific Windows 10/11 drivers are available to ensure compatibility. Manual Installation: Device Manager Right-click the "USB Printing Support" or "Unknown Device." Update Driver and point to the folder containing the downloaded Configuration:

After installation, you can adjust paper size and cutting settings via Printer Properties in the Windows Control Panel. for your printer brand?

The Usbprint Printerpos-802bc2 is a hardware identifier typically associated with 80mm thermal receipt printers that use the ESC/POS command set. This specific string often appears in the Windows Device Manager when a generic or OEM thermal printer is connected via a USB port, indicating that the system recognizes the device as a "USB Printing Support" entity but may require a specific driver to function as a POS printer. 3. The Cash Drawer Does Not Open

Cause: The usbprint.sys generic driver does not pass the cash drawer kick-out command. Fix: This requires a full manufacturer driver. If that fails, you may need to use a printer with a serial (RS-232) port or install a print server that translates ESC/POS commands.
